A creditor’s obligation to assess the creditworthiness of a consumer

Ganado SARL | March 14, 2024

In examining the case of Nárokuj s.r.o. v EC Financial Services, a.s (C-755/22), the Court of Justice of the European Union (the “CJEU”) considered the obligation which banks are subject to prior to the granting of credit to consumers.

Amendment to Subcontracting Act (Maximum 5 Times Punitive Damages for Misappropriation of Technology)

Lee & Ko | March 13, 2024

The Korea Fair Trade Commission’s (KFTC) proposed amendment to the Fair Transactions in Subcontracting Act (Subcontracting Act) was approved by the National Assembly during its plenary session on February 1, 2024 and will take effect on August 28, 2024.

Tax on Foreign Banks Operating in the Emirate of Dubai

Galadari Advocates & Legal Consultants | March 12, 2024

His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President, Prime Minister, and Ruler of the Emirate of Dubai issued Law No. 1 of 2024 regarding Tax on Foreign Banks Operating in the Emirate of Dubai (“Law”).
